The Feast of Our Lady Woman of Valor 2025


Last Saturday (10.05.25) the Pastoral Center of Our Lady Woman of Valor in Tel Aviv celebrated its feast. Here is a short report from this joyful event.


About 150 people gathered to celebrate the Eucharist. The main celebrant, Fr. David Neuhaus, was accompanied by ten priests, including the Vicar of St. James, Fr. Piotr Zelazko, and the Vicar of VMAS, Fr. Matthew Coutinho. The Ambassador of the Republic of the Philippines, Mrs. Aileen Mendiola-Rau honored the event with her presence.

Various groups of migrants were present: Filipinos, Indians, Sri Lankans, Ethiopians, Eritreans, and, for the first time, Hebrew-speaking children who study catechism at the center. They actively participated in the Mass, singing the entrance song, "Lord Have Mercy," and "Glory" in Hebrew. Guided by Luca and Neil, their performance was fantastic.

After the Eucharist, everyone was invited to a food party in the courtyard. Among the various kinds of food was a large table prepared by the parents of the catechism children under the guidance of Bhea.

Big thanks to all who helped to prepare the feast.
